Featuring a Carry-On, a Large Check-In, a Rolling Duffel, a Boarding Tote and a Toiletry Kit, the Seville 2.0 5-Piece Luggage Set is the perfect way to get the functional style and flexible features you need for all your travels.

From a weekend getaway with the entire family to an epic solo journey, this collection includes all of the pieces you could ever need.

The generous capacity suitcases feature 360° spinner wheel system, offering excellent mobility and maneuverability.

The rolling duffel incorporates two smooth-rolling in-line wheels to enhance stability and ease of motion.

The boarding tote includes exterior pockets to keep travel essentials handy, while the toiletry kit is the perfect size for traveling.

Lightweight, durable exterior fabric resists abrasion and tearing while providing superior protection against the elements.

Care Instructions:
To Clean:
Clean with a soft, damp cloth. For stains, we suggest a luggage cleaner or a mixture of equal parts water and isopropyl alcohol. Avoid using cleaning products containing bleach. Adhesive lint rollers work great to remove lint and dust.

To Store:
Store your luggage in an upright position in a dry location. Avoid storing luggage in extreme temperatures. To conveniently save space, all sizes from this collection nest (fit neatly) inside each other. Just open the largest suitcase and set the smaller size(s)—with the wheels facing the same direction—inside. Close lids and zip the outermost bag closed. When you're not out there exploring the world, we recommend keeping your luggage covered while being stored.

Disclaimer: Longtime follower and subscriber to Jay LaCroix’s YouTube site, Learn Linux TV. Several high quality authors (Jang, van Vugt, and Ghori the most well known) have been introducing new comers looking for more in-depth guides to Linux to the Red Hat world through their RHCSA Study Guides. The same cannot be said for Ubuntu. While books do exist for Ubuntu, they are too general in this reviewers opinion. A noted exception is Matthew Helmke. The other is Jay LaCroix. Mastering Ubuntu Server, 4th Edition by Jay LaCroix addresses Canonical’s latest Ubuntu release, 22.04 LTS (Jammy Jellyfish). Mr. LaCroix’s book follows the same outline as the RHCSA books of installation, user management, package management, navigating the file system through the terminal, command-line usage, up to and including storage and networking. These chapters lay a solid foundation for the rest of the book, and all but one chapter ends with a section for further viewing or reading which either point to Mr. LaCroix’s well produced videos on his YouTube channel, Ubuntu’s wiki, or to one of several informative websites. The YouTube videos are a good complement to the book, and also raise the bar for what we as readers should expect from other authors and publishers. The last part of the book was my favorite. Where as the RHCSA books are confined to the scope of the test they are aimed at, Mastering Ubuntu Server has no restrictions. Chapters covering the installation of databases (MariaDB), web servers (both Apache and Nginx), virtualization (QEMU/KVM), containerization (LXD and Docker), Ansible, AWS, and Terraform along with their corresponding videos (except for Terraform) create a comprehensive learning platform. Having worked through some of these chapters along with the videos, one does get up to speed much quicker in understanding while adding a new skill to their skillset. This is important in a competitive job market. I would recommend Mastering Ubuntu Server, 4 th Edition highly to anyone wanting something current for the 22.04 LTS distribution. Having said that, I do have some admittedly subjective criticisms. In the chapter on storage, the fdisk command is introduced for formatting and partitioning disks. In an industry where it is becoming less likely to install a hard drive of 2TB or less and manufacturers have 20TB hard drives in their product line, why not also introduce the gdisk command. My other criticism is directed at the virtualization chapter and its use of Virtual Machine Manager for KVM. I got my start working with KVM through the Virtual Machine Manager as well, but on the advice of a Systems Engineer I knew, transitioned to creating, configuring and managing all my VMs through the command-line only. I wished that the author pushed more in that direction. As I said, subjective opinions, and minor overall, for a well written book by Jay LaCroix.
